Judge Judy, season 21 episode 272 features three distinct cases that deal with various issues plaguing society.
The first case is titled "Sardines and Dr. Pepper Vandal!" and sees the plaintiff suing her ex-roommate for property destruction. The plaintiff explains that her ex-roommate, the defendant, who was upset over a petty argument, emptied several cans of sardines and poured Dr. Pepper all over the plaintiff's belongings, causing costly damage. The defendant vehemently denies the accusations, stating that she did not damage any of the plaintiff's things and that the plaintiff only wants revenge for their falling out. Judge Judy, being her usual blunt self, grills both parties, examining the evidence presented, and ultimately delivers a ruling that will satisfy the winner.
The second case, "Motorcycle T-Bone Crash!" occurs when a man sues his ex-girlfriend for the damages he incurred in a motorcycle accident. The plaintiff, who was operating his motorcycle at the time of the incident, claims that his ex-girlfriend, who was traveling in a car at the intersection, didn't give him enough time to cross the road, causing a T-bone collision that resulted in injuries and property damage. The defendant argues that the plaintiff was going too fast and should have been more careful, and that he is responsible for his own injuries. Judge Judy listens to both sides' arguments and examines the evidence presented, ultimately determining who should be awarded compensation.
